Four bar linkage simulation matlab pdf

Bourkes algorithm calculates the x,y coordinates of the two red points where the circles intersect. From the library, drag four revolute joint blocks into the model. An optimal synthesis method of adjustable four bar linkages for. We calculate the velocity and acceleration of the end effector e, given a 1 radsec angular velocity of the crank.

Project assignment make your own four bar linkage simulator in matlab. It tracks every rod of the mechanism and displays its position at various angles. A custom library with compound body subsystem blocks opens up. To better visualize the animation, make sure you can see both the command window and. Kinematic synthesis of planar four bar linkage jiting li, mileta m. Kinematics modeling and simulation of a passive fourbar. Pdf to analyse the curvature properties of a fourbar mechanism. Taking time derivative of previous velocity equation 5. Four bar linkage is the simplest of all closed loop linkage have 3 three moving link, 1 fixed link and 4 pin joints there is only one constraint on the linkage, which defines a definite motion r2 r3 r 4 a b p d c coupler.

The connector link is a slightly modified version of the same link. Bicycles achieve this conversion with two fourbar linkages, each consisting of the two segments of the riders leg, the bicycle frame, and the crank, as shown below. Analytical synthesis and analysis of mechanisms using matlab and. Application of four bar mechanisms to machinery is numerous. Robotics system toolbox doesnt directly support closedloop mechanisms. For experimental analysis of four bar mechanism, a wooden model has been developed figure. It is an evolving product developed in mechatronics lab, department of mechanical engineering at iit delhi, new delhi, india, under the guidance of prof. Matlab animation tutorial fourbar linkage mechanism codes in description duration. Matlab program for 4 bar mechanism position analysis and. This work was done as a homework of applied mechanics and machine course at university. To better visualize the animation, make sure you can see both the command window and the figure at the same time.

This example shows how to assemble instances of a modularly designed link into a four bar mechanism crankrocker type. Four bar synthesis for 3 known coupler positions duration. This example shows how to solve inverse kinematics for a four bar linkage, a simple planar closedchain linkage. Pdf design, synthesis and simulation of four bar mechanism for. Graphic user interface windowsfor data input and output as well asfor simulation. It consists of four bodies, called bars or links, connected in a loop by four joints. These figure 1 the nortons four bar program figure 2 a working model file of a four bar. One of the links is fixed to the world frame and acts as a ground. Mechanical designers often wish to design mechanisms that will enable an end effector to follow a certain path.

The connector link is a slightly modified version of the. Keep pressing on the enter key when prompted by the code. A four link mechanism with four revolute joints is commonly called a four bar mechanism. In simscape multibody, you actuate a joint directly using the joint block. These motion characteristics are then used for simulation of the mechanism. Four bar in a four bar mechanism, generally for a known angle, velocity and acceleration of the. I know there is something wrong with the sharp angle at the top. The application is designed primaly to support the design of multybody mechanisms. Position study of a fourbar mechanism using matlab the. This link is replaced here by two pivot mounts connected through a rigid translation transform. Design, synthesis and simulation of four bar mechanism for eliminate the plowing depth fluctuations in tractors article pdf available may 20 with 2,026 reads how we measure reads.

The script uses the coupler motion coordinates, obtained using a transform sensor block, to plot the resulting coupler curve at each value of the coupler length. Kinematic synthesis of the fourbar mechanism using the complex number method is presented. When the position of a driven side link fixed pivot is adjusted, multiphase motion can be generated by the same four bar linkage. Analyze motion at various parameter values model overview. This example shows a four bar linkage modeled in simscape multibody that is optimized using matlab so that the tip of the linkage follows a desired trajectory. The artificial knee was modeled as a two dimensional sagittal plane linkage, consisting of two segments with a four bar mechanism with magnetorheological fluid damper that simulates the action of the muscle as shown in figs.

A fourbar linkage, also called a four bar, is the simplest movable closedchain linkage. Pdf in this paper, a four bar mechanism was designed for the specified. Design, synthesis and simulation of four bar mechanism for. Pdf analysis of the curvature properties of the link lengths of a fourbar mechanism via mathematical modeling techniques using matlab. Virkmodeling and simulation of a passive lowerbody mechanism for rehabilitation.

The grashofs law can be applied to categorise the four bar linkage mechanismus. The crank and rocker links are copies of the same link, with different length, density and color parameters. However, the loopclosing joints can be approximated using kinematic constraints. The lower arm is just rotating and then i find the intersection of two circles with a radius of the upper arm and the coupling arm. Graphical synthesis using matlab for a four bar quick return mechanism is a successful approach that will help in designing a mechanism and satisfy all the. Analysis of fourbar linkages model using regression.

Doublecrank, rockercrank, doublerocker and change point. This example shows how to model a four bar a closed kinematic chain comprising four bodies that connect through revolute joints. Solve inverse kinematics for a fourbar linkage matlab. Matlabsimmechanics based control of four bar passive lowerbody mechanism. Fourbar linkage analysis position analysis coupler curve plotting animation. In this video i derive the equations of the points of interest of the fourbar linkage using some simple geometry relations. Hence a positive r 4 shows that the slider 4 slides in the same direction of r4. Mechanism design simulink fourbar deployment demo james gopsill. This matlab code is a simulation of four bar linkage. Generally, the joints are configured so the links move in parallel planes, and the assembly is called a planar fourbar linkage. Analysis and simulation files three matlab files, one shown in figure 3, are written to perform position, velocity, and acceleration analysis of three types of mechanism.

The velocity term r 4 is known as the sliding relative velocity of slider 4 on link 3, or va4a3, or va2a3. In this example, you prescribe the actuation torque for a revolute joint in a four bar linkage. Matlab international journal of recent engineering science. The synthesis results can be validated by simulation. Hi, im trying to make a parallelogram 4 bar linkage but my output link keeps failing to rotate in a circle the link on the right side. Simulation of the motion of a four bar prosthetic knee. Matlab programs are written for solving the equations. Four bar linkage all configurations file exchange matlab. Link mechanisms like four bar linkage systems are often used having one active and three passive links and are. Dimensional synthesis of 4 bar link mechanisms helps the designer to. Transmission angles transmission angle plotting velocity analysis acceleration analysis force analysis kinematic analysis with constant angular velocity for link 2 dynamic analysis with constant angular velocity for link 2 fourbar linkage synthesis. All this is illustrated on an example of synthesis of a four bar linkage whose. The new maps developed can be used for synthesis of four bar. Matlabsimmechanics based control of fourbar passive.

Linkage simulation linkage algorithms and their application. The results of the synthesis process are analyzed to determine ftlotion characteristics of the mechanism. Linkage analysis and simulation using matlab and working. Spherical and spatial four bar linkages also exist and are used in practice.

In this example the configuration is set to crankrocker, since the sum of lengths of the longest and shortest links is less than the sum of lengths of the other two links and the crank has the shortest length. Each bar of a linkage can trace a circle by rotating it around its joint, as shown in the image to the right. The first and second time derivative of the algebraic position equations provide the velocity and acceleration. The main objective of this homework is to lead a complete analysis on a crankrocker four bar linkage subjected only to its weight. In this example, you prescribe the actuation torque for a revolute joint in a four bar linkage model. Four bar linkage optimization in simscape file exchange.

467 1211 347 739 1205 1089 942 1171 909 988 78 1375 1156 1279 1220 584 1415 946 285 624 1225 1286 1397 88 649 621 418 930 1197 17 1250